Camps guitars is a renowned and acknowledged Spanish guitar manufacture that stands for quality, artisanship, and innovation. Since 1945, this family business has been making first-class Spanish guitars with a total commitment to high-quality craftsmanship. Jordi and Javier Camps, the sons of founder Juan Camps, run this successful manufacture based in Girona (Spain), which employs highly qualified luthiers. The Primera Blanca model is part of the prestigious line called “Hermanos Camps”. It was developed in collaboration with concert artist and professor Manuel Granados. Its design is aimed at providing the best playing experience and excellent sound.
This traditional flamenco model with cypress back and sides is a very light, responsive and percussive guitar. It has a crystalline sound and fantastic dynamic possibilities.
